Black bear unafraid of hunters runs in terror from an even bigger bear looking for food

Natalie Krebs was pleasantly surprised by her first bear hunt in Saskatchewan, Canada. After being in the field for nearly a week with her cameras rolling, she realized the native black bears, “were curious, bold, and infinitely fascinating to watch.” She eagerly watched the bait barrels for days as a sow and her cubs took advantage of the free food. Then, on day 4, as a smaller male bear fled one of the bait sites, she realized there must be a bigger bear about. When the 6-foot bruiser finally emerged, Natalie knew it was time for her first shot to count. What she didn’t realize was that she was about to bag her first bear.
